Thai BBQ prawns

Prep Time:
20 minutes
Cook Time:
5 minutes
Total Time:
25 minutes
Asian greens and juicy prawns with zesty lime and fresh mint, ready in just 25 minutes.
Ingredients:
  • 1kg raw banana prawns, peeled leaving tails intact, deveined
  • 18.40 gm vegetable oil
  • 2 tsp fresh ginger, grated
  • 2 bunches pak choy, halved lengthways
  • 2 bunches gai lan (Chinese broccoli)
  • 1/2 ripe pineapple, peeled, halved, cored, thinly sliced
  • 21.00 gm lime juice
  • 18.30 gm gluten-free fish sauce
  • 125.00 ml mint leaves
  • 1/4 red onion, thinly sliced
  • 1 long fresh red chilli, finely chopped
  • Steamed rice, to serve
Instructions:
  • Heat up the barbecue flat plate or a large frying pan on high heat. Combine prawns, oil, and ginger in a bowl and mix well. Dip the pak choy and gai lan in water, then grill on the barbecue for 1-2 minutes until lightly charred and tender. Transfer to a plate and cover with foil.
  • Barbecue the prawn mixture for 1 minute, then add pineapple and continue cooking until prawns change color. Stir in lime juice and fish sauce, ensuring everything is evenly coated. Transfer the mixture to a platter, then top with mint, onion, and chili. Toss gently to combine and serve with vegetables and rice.
